对于之前已经安装过MariaDb的用户,希望保留MariaDb的同时也能安装Mysql8最新版本。那如何完成在windows10中两个数据库的同时运行呢?下面就是具体步骤:下载Mysql8链接: https://dev.mysql.com/downloads/mysql/ 根据自己的windows操作系统选择64位或32位完成下载。得到安装zip文件。安装Mysql81、解压刚刚下载好的压缩包到你
转载
2023-10-20 15:51:46
248阅读
MySQL支持从一个发行版本到下一个更高发行版本的复制。例如,您可以从运行MySQL 5.6的主服务器复制到运行MySQL 5.7的从服务器,从运行MySQL 5.7的主服务器复制到运行MySQL 8.0的从服务器,依此类推。但是,如果主服务器使用语句或依赖于从服务器上使用的MySQL版本不再支持的行为,则从较旧的主服务器复制到较新的从服务器时,可能会遇到困难。例如,MySQL 8.0不再支持超过
转载
2023-08-14 22:18:16
560阅读
### 实现MySQL8兼容模式的步骤与代码示例
#### 简介
MySQL是一种常用的关系型数据库管理系统,而兼容模式则是MySQL 8版本中的一种兼容性设置,用于向后兼容MySQL 5.7及之前的版本。本文将向刚入行的小白开发者介绍如何实现MySQL8的兼容模式。
#### 步骤概览
下面是实现MySQL8兼容模式的步骤概览,我们将在接下来的内容中逐步展开。
| 步骤 | 描述 |
| -
原创
2023-12-29 09:11:49
229阅读
# TiDB兼容MySQL 8的探索之旅
TiDB是一个分布式的数据库,具有良好的可扩展性和高可用性。而随着TiDB 5.0版本的发布,它开始全面兼容MySQL 8。这为开发者和数据工程师提供了更多灵活性,可以利用TiDB的优势,同时保持对MySQL的熟悉感。在本文中,我们将通过一些具体的代码示例,来探讨TiDB兼容MySQL 8的特点。
## TiDB的优势
在深入兼容性之前,让我们先了解
# MariaDB 兼容 MySQL 8
MySQL 和 MariaDB 是两种常见的关系型数据库管理系统,它们之间存在很多共通之处,但也有一些不同点。在使用过程中,有时候我们需要将数据库从 MySQL 迁移到 MariaDB,或者反之。好在 MariaDB 可以兼容 MySQL 8,这就意味着可以较为轻松地在两者之间进行迁移。
## MariaDB 和 MySQL 8 的兼容性
Maria
原创
2024-07-12 03:20:06
132阅读
1、问题描述WIN10安装的MySQL久一点不用了,发现突然用不了了。怎么搞也搞不回来了,一怒之下重装了,重新下载了一个更新的版本下来,解压用了之前的配置文件(之前的配置导致我重新安装初始化出现问题)。我遇到的问题原因就是MySQL8不给你破坏原则,初始化时配置文件不能有多余的设置,大家可以直接复制我下面这份也可以用,多余的设置注释掉了。特别注意!!! “data文件夹”不
转载
2024-10-13 13:20:28
122阅读
# EF兼容MySQL8的实现流程
## 1. 安装MySQL Connector/NET
首先,我们需要安装MySQL Connector/NET,它是MySQL官方提供的ADO.NET驱动程序。你可以从MySQL官方网站上下载并安装最新版本的MySQL Connector/NET。
## 2. 创建一个空的.NET Core项目
在Visual Studio中,创建一个空的.NET Cor
原创
2023-12-09 08:03:57
106阅读
# MariaDB 兼容 MySQL 8 的探索之旅
MariaDB 是一种开源关系型数据库管理系统(RDBMS),最初是 MySQL 的一个分支。随着时间的推移,MariaDB 不仅已经发展成为一个独立的项目,还逐渐实现了与 MySQL 的高度兼容性,尤其是与 MySQL 8 的兼容性。本文将探讨 MariaDB 如何兼容 MySQL 8,以及一些具体的代码示例让你更好地理解这一点。
##
3.0中不推荐使用的功能django.utils.encoding.force_text()和smart_text()的别名被弃用。如果您的代码支持Python 2,smart_str()并且 force_str()在此处有所不同,请忽略此弃用。杂项django.utils.http.urlquote(),urlquote_plus(),urlunquote(),并urlunquote_
转载
2024-07-21 18:14:44
40阅读
# MySQL 8与UTF-8的兼容性深入解析
在当今的数据库技术中,字符编码是一项至关重要的组成部分,尤其是在全球化的互联网环境中。MySQL是最流行的关系型数据库之一,它在最新的版本8中进一步提升了对UTF-8字符集的支持。在这篇文章中,我们将详细探讨MySQL 8如何兼容UTF-8,以及如何在实际应用中配置和使用。
## UTF-8与MySQL
UTF-8是一种可变长度的字符编码方式,
与 MySQL 兼容性对比TiDB 100% 兼容 MySQL 5.7 协议、MySQL 5.7 常用的功能及语法。MySQL 5.7 生态中的系统工具(PHPMyAdmin、Navicat、MySQL Workbench、mysqldump、Mydumper/Myloader)、客户端等均适用于 TiDB。但 TiDB 尚未支持一些 MySQL 功能,可能的原因如下:有更好的解决方案,例如 JS
转载
2023-08-17 09:23:38
227阅读
MySQL 8新特性选择MySQL 8的背景:MySQL 5.6已经停止版本更新了,对于 MySQL 5.7 版本,其将于 2023年 10月31日 停止支持。后续官方将不再进行后续的代码维护。 另外,MySQL 8.0 全内存访问可以轻易跑到 200W QPS,I/O 极端高负载场景跑到 16W QPS,如下图:上面三个图来自于MySQL官网:www.mysql.com/why-mysql/b…
转载
2023-08-29 19:46:07
1277阅读
# 使用Doris实现MySQL 8语法兼容性
## 1. 概述
在当今数据驱动的环境中,选择合适的数据库管理系统至关重要。Apache Doris是一个高效的实时分析型数据库,可以实现对MySQL语法的兼容,特别是MySQL 8版本。本文将介绍实现Doris兼容MySQL 8语法的步骤,确保你能够顺利完成任务。
## 2. 流程步骤
| 步骤 | 任务描述
原创
2024-10-03 03:48:14
134阅读
# 解决MySQL8不兼容CDATA的问题
## 简介
MySQL8对于CDATA标记的处理与之前版本有所不同,这可能导致一些旧代码在升级到MySQL8时出现兼容性问题。本文将指导你解决MySQL8不兼容CDATA的问题,并提供相应的代码示例。
## 解决流程
下面是解决MySQL8不兼容CDATA的流程,你可以根据这个表格逐步操作。
| 步骤 | 操作 |
|---|---|
| 1
原创
2024-01-02 11:14:23
59阅读
MySQL 5.7.28 在Windows 10 专业版上安装,总是失败,其原因主要是更新的操作系统(2019年11月)和老旧的安装包mysql-installer-community-5.7.28.0.msi不兼容了。最关键的点是inno db创建数据库初始文件的时候参数不对,installer安装过程中无法在my.ini中添加如下参数。innodb_flush_method=normal可选的
由于本地用的集成环境是 phpStudy 2018,没有找到升级 MySQL 版本的选项,所以自己升级一下。找了众多方式都失效,要么有问题不能用,哎,想当回懒人看来是不行了,自己动手吧!从官网上下载高版本的 MySQL :https://dev.mysql.com/downloads/file/?id=467269,选的版本是 5.7.17。 步骤:1.备份原来 phpStu
转载
2024-09-18 13:52:41
49阅读
# 如何在 MySQL 8 中开启兼容模式
在使用 MySQL 8 的过程中,你可能会遇到一些兼容性问题,尤其是从旧版本(如 MySQL 5.x)迁移时。MySQL 8 引入了许多新特性和改进,但有时旧应用可能依赖于早期版本的某些行为。为了满足这些需求,我们可以通过开启兼容模式来确保系统的稳定性和兼容性。本文将详细介绍如何在 MySQL 8 中开启兼容模式,包括流程概述、具体步骤、代码示例和可视
原创
2024-08-08 13:53:12
300阅读
InnoDB存储引擎实现了如下两种标准的行级锁:共享锁(S Lock),允许事务读一行数据。排他锁(X LocK),允许事务删除或更新一行数据。如果一个事务T1已经获得了行r的共享锁,那么另外的事务T2可以立即获得行r的共享锁,因为读取并没有改变行r的数据,称这种情况为锁兼容( Lock Compatible)。 但若有其他的事务T3想获得行r的排他锁,则其必须等待事务T1、T2释放行r上的共享锁
目录1. 异常现象MySQL 官方解释 解决方法方法1: 修改sql_mode查询sql_mode设置,发现有ONLY_FULL_GROUP_BY修改sql_mode设置方法2: select非group by的字段MySQL 5.7: sql_modesql_mode参数说明参考连接 1. 异常现象数据库在迁移后执行SQL出现了问题, 报错信息如下SELECT li
转载
2024-05-19 18:06:47
257阅读
Windows10中同时安装MySQL5和MySQL8前言:在实际环境中不会同时安装两个数据库,但是在自己学习中就会用到两个数据库,一个工作使用,一个了解前沿技术。一、下载好两个版本的数据库MySQL官网下载:https://www.mysql.com/ 1.1、点击Download->Community。 1.2、查找需要的MySQL版本。 我下载的都是 64 位系统的。 进入是下载MyS
转载
2023-11-10 17:43:09
71阅读